Hey! You made it through the first week of Mental Health Month. Have you been following along with our weekly prompts? Last week was all about posting it for yourself. Youâre the most important person in your life, you know? Gotta take care of yourself the best you can.
This week is about focusing on each other. Focus on being an encouraging and understanding friend, or part of a supportive community. Even just being there to listen or get leaned on can make a huge difference in someoneâs life. Thereâs no wrong way to show kindness. Here are some other suggestions to bring this kind of supportive kindness to your Tumblr:
Create a post with positive message for someone going through a tough time. Make a text post, a video post, use stickers, make a GIFâwhatever feels right to you.
Message someone a compliment. Maybe send them a sticker.
This is the positivity cat. Message it to 17 of your friends to give them positive vibes all month long. đ
Leave a nice reply on someoneâs post.
If youâre up for it, make a post that your ask box is open to anyone who needs to chat.
Youâre never alone on Tumblr. Turn your dashboard into a mental health community and follow these search tags: #postitforward, #self-care, and #positivity.
Reblog and tag your friends on this post or mention them in the replies to remind them to drink water.
If you follow through, and we hope you do, make sure to tag your posts with #postitforward so other people can find your stuff.
We hope you have a good week, Tumblr. Donât forget, weâre always here for you too. <3Â

Hey, Tumblr.
Today is May 1. The first day of Mental Health Month. This entire month we want to nudge all of you to celebrate triumphs, acknowledge struggles, and just come together. Let other people know theyâre not alone. Feel less alone yourself. Itâs what Post it Forward is all about.
One of the incredible ways youâall of youâhave helped shape Tumblr is with your ability to be open and honest. Â It was you that turned this platform into a community, one based on genuine expression, creativity, and acceptance.
Neat. How can I participate?
Glad you asked! Each week, for all four weeks, weâll be giving you ideas for ways to Post it Forward.
Week 1âPost it for you: How you practice self-care and personal well-being.
Week 2âPost it for each other: Ways you can be there for each other.
Week 3âPost it for reflection: Sharing stories of personal growth and development.
Week 4âPost it for the future: Committing to continuous reflection and improvement.
This week is all about posting for you. Acts of self-care. Here are some places to start:
Post an emoji spell for self-care and positivity. đ đź đ đ±
Share a photo or GIF of something that calms you down. Donât have one? Hereâs one.
Whatâs the one thing that always cheers you up? Post a photo of it, take a GIF, or illustrate it. Toss a sticker on it, if youâd like.
Never forget that you are valid! Post a selfie with âvalidâ sticker (see below).
Make a list of things you like about yourself.
Make a checklist of 5 acts of self-care you promise to do for yourself this week.
Make an audio post with a song that helps you zone out and re-energize.
Donât forget to tag all your posts with #postitforward this month! It makes it easier for everyone to find each otherâs contributions.
